Zambia Visa

About Zambia Zambia, formally the Republic of Zambia, is a landlocked country in central southern Africa divided from Zimbabwe by the Zambezi River. Angola, Botswana, the Democratic Republic of the Congo, Malawi, Mozambique, Namibia, and Tanzania border Zambia. It is easy to get Zambian Visa. The country is slightly greater […]

Zambian Visa | Documents required